    Rigid tapping not authorised G84.1

    Hello everybody!

    I have Cincinnati Dart 500 from 1999. Last time i tried to tap with cycle G84.1. Unfortunately, the machine showed me an alarm:

    Does this mean that I have to install hardware elements? Or I need to unlock with special code?

    Re: Rigid tapping not authorised G84.1

    The dart is a basic machine/control, you need to contact Mike Trunk at FIVES 800-934-0735 to get a code. You should press MORE then CONFIG then PURCHASED OPTIONS to see what you have.
